diff options
author | Valerij Fredriksen <valerijf@verizonmedia.com> | 2020-01-15 16:48:12 +0100 |
---|---|---|
committer | Valerij Fredriksen <valerijf@verizonmedia.com> | 2020-01-15 16:51:06 +0100 |
commit | c92b8dce8fe317b0ee6f2b0d4846af57b75329ce (patch) | |
tree | ac861fd2b4a49650023f8acada6736e6a4f1df5c /node-admin | |
parent | 3569aed27599882b26039c7d25a89bce10cbc02b (diff) |
Catch ConvergenceException
Diffstat (limited to 'node-admin')
-rw-r--r-- | node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/nodeadmin/NodeAdminStateUpdater.java |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/nodeadmin/NodeAdminStateUpdater.java b/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/nodeadmin/NodeAdminStateUpdater.java index e375769882a..cb209d710c8 100644 --- a/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/nodeadmin/NodeAdminStateUpdater.java +++ b/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/nodeadmin/NodeAdminStateUpdater.java @@ -11,6 +11,7 @@ import com.yahoo.vespa.hosted.node.admin.configserver.noderepository.NodeState; import com.yahoo.vespa.hosted.node.admin.configserver.orchestrator.Orchestrator; import com.yahoo.vespa.hosted.node.admin.nodeagent.NodeAgentContext; import com.yahoo.vespa.hosted.node.admin.nodeagent.NodeAgentContextFactory; +import com.yahoo.yolean.Exceptions; import java.time.Clock; import java.time.Duration; @@ -174,6 +175,8 @@ public class NodeAdminStateUpdater { aclByHostname.getOrDefault(hostname, Acl.EMPTY))) .collect(Collectors.toSet()); nodeAdmin.refreshContainersToRun(nodeAgentContexts); + } catch (ConvergenceException e) { + log.log(LogLevel.WARNING, "Failed to update which containers should be running: " + Exceptions.toMessageString(e)); } catch (RuntimeException e) { log.log(LogLevel.WARNING, "Failed to update which containers should be running", e); } |